Computer Records Stolen from University Health Care
Credit Dan Bammes
University of Utah Senior Vice-President Lorris Betz, University Health Care CEO David Entwhistle and Salt Lake County Sheriff Jim Winder at a news conference June 10th on the records theft.
By Dan Bammes
Salt Lake City, UT – The University of Utah health care system is notifying more than two million patients whose billing records were included in a set of backup tapes stolen from a courier's car. Dan Bammes has more.
